THE Vanua Shield will be re-introduced into the Tailevu Rugby Union club competition next season.
This is after the games committee graded the clubs into two divisions — the Senior First and Senior Second.
The Vanua Shield will then be the challenge trophy for the Senior 1st while a new trophy will be introduced for the Senior 2nd.
TRU official Tevita Bolavanua said they could introduce the Vanua Shield challenge this season.
"Next year we will have teams challenging the Vanua Shield once more. We have a new format this season so we could not continue with the challenge matches. It was like this last year," he said.
"What we are doing is to grade teams into Senior First and Senior Second. The Senior First will then compete for the Vanua Shield next year while we will find another trophy for the Senior Second," Bolavanua said.
Meanwhile, today, Army Tailevu will play Mokani in the finals of the first round of club competition.
Army boasts some provincial reps like Leone Nakarawa, Sevuloni Lutu, Sunia Bainivalu, Mosese Vasuitoga and Manueli Gade.
Tailevu skipper Esiria Vueti will lead the pack for Mokani and Fiji under-20 fullback Tikilaci Vuibau will man the number 15 jumper.
The game kicks-off at 3.30pm today.
